Transaction 22c55ccd41cc33ea54471639cb2340468d25812eb93281001e0881ebe3fc761a

1 Input
2 Outputs
  • 22c55ccd41cc33ea54471639cb2340468d25812eb93281001e0881ebe3fc761a:0
  • value  95000000
    address  363RYkUoSL3gnShqfP3Gr2PByUsxWCr1hK
  • 22c55ccd41cc33ea54471639cb2340468d25812eb93281001e0881ebe3fc761a:1
  • value  4994411
    address  3K3x9fx9S77kfTQeyK2kXdx3RrVr1JVQJm